We know that it isn't browser dependent and it effects any browser on the computer as well as any site. You still haven't said if you can FTP things or not, as that is different.
I would imagine that it's only localized to your computer and not your network (since that would make little sense) So, firewall stuff is out (if it were being blocked by a router firewall you would simply get no response ... the router can't close programs that are running on your computer).
So the only option is that some process is running that isn't allowing you to do it. Be aware that there are many malicious programs that aren't particularly detectable by anti-virus or anti-spyware/adware software.
Check your running processes for anything suspicious (use google to look up the process names, you will get a full description.)
If you want a very quick fix. You can use diagnostic most, which turns off everything that isn't necessary to windows running. Though you'd have to have the system process for networking ability activated, otherwise it wont do you any good.
Though it could be the Windows firewall if you have SP2. I'm not familiar how that thing works since I don't particularly trust MS and thus I don't have it installed.
There's actually one more thing it could be. It could be something wrong with Windows. Do any of the other "windows accessing functions" kill your browser? Like, any action in your browser that asks you to browse your computer, for whatever reason, like save as or open sort of stuff?
If so, it might be an issue with windows it self. Though, I think, if it were it'd be more likely that you'd get a stop message ... but maybe not. Do you get the Windows Send Error message? If you don't get one of those, and you have that deactivated, turn it back on, it should give some information. If you have it on and there's no message, it sounds like there's another process stopping the browsers rather than the browsers halting unexpectedly to the OS.
